Abstract: 3,3′,4,4′-Tetrachlorobiphenyl (TTCB) has been studied in the presence of cationic, anionic, neutral surfactants, α-cyclodextrin and β-cyclodextrin. The enhancement of the fluorescence of this polychlorobiphenyl in polyoxyethylene (10) lauryl ether (POLE) medium has been used to develop a spectrofluorimetric method for the sensitive determination of TTCB. Variables such as the concentration of surfactant, percentage of organic solvent, and temperature, together with the possible interferences of eighteen different polychlorinated biphenyls and Aroclors have been studied. The method, which has a detection limit of 1.4 ng ml−1, has been applied to the determination of TTCB added to sea water with acceptable recovery.
